%r rendered as %s — silently, and only for strings

Measured

print("%r" % "v")        # CPython 'v'      pxx v      WRONG
print("%s" % "v")        # CPython v        pxx v      ok
print("%r" % 5)          # CPython 5        pxx 5      ok
print("%r" % [1, 2])     # CPython [1, 2]   pxx [1, 2] ok
print("%s=%r" % ("k","v")) # CPython k='v'  pxx k=v    WRONG

%r is repr(), not str(). The %-format conversion switch lumped the two together in one arm:

's', 'r':
  outS := outS + PyFmtPad(pyvar_print_of(cur), width, False, leftAlign);

Only string operands diverge, which is exactly what hid it: repr and str agree for numbers and booleans, and pxx's containers already render repr-style, so every non-string probe looked correct.

Fix

Split the arm. pyvar_repr already quotes a string and delegates list/dict/bytes to their own repr, so this is one call, not new logic.

Second bug in the same pass: repr's QUOTE SELECTION

repr("it's") gave 'it\'s' where CPython gives "it's". Python prefers ', switches to " when the string contains a single quote and NO double quote, and keeps ' (escaping it) when it contains both. PyReprQuote always used '.

Fixed with a Boolean and two explicit branches — deliberately NOT a delim: Char variable. The first attempt used one, and it silently emitted EMPTY delimiters: a Char VARIABLE does not convert to a string the way a Char CONST does, because the conversion is keyed on the expression SHAPE rather than its type (project_string_conversion_shape_blindspot_pattern). That landmine is live and cost a build cycle here.

Verified

test/test_nilpy_percent_repr.npy, wired into make test-nilpy, byte-identical to CPython. Confirmed RED pre-fix (v where 'v' is required). Covers %r of str / int / float / list / dict / bool, %r with width and left-align padding, %s alongside it, the other conversions (%d %05.2f %x), and all three quote-selection cases (single only, double only, both).
